1. Prepare the surface
Ensure the surface is porous, dry and clean. Lightly sand wood to open the grain if needed.
2. Shake & Apply
On fabric, brush, dab or use a sponge. On wood, apply with a brush.
3. Dilute with water
This is optional for lighter tones or a more translucent Scandinavian wash on wood.
4. Build your layers
Deeper colour is achieved with additional coats.
5. Drying & sealing
Bleo is self-sealing on many porous surfaces and waterproof once fully dry.

100 ml covers approx. 1.5 to 2 m² 250 ml covers 4 to 6 m² Coverage depends on surface absorbency, texture and material type. Highly porous or high-pile fabrics (like velvet) may require more paint or additional coats. Lighter shades may also need extra layering for full opacity.
One coat gives soft, natural colour that enhances the surface without hiding its texture. A second coat deepens the tone and increases coverage, especially on more absorbent materials. BLEO can be layered or blended to achieve your desired finish. Always apply in thin, even coats for best results.
Bleo can be applied with a soft synthetic brush, foam brush or sponge, depending on the surface and desired effect. Its gel-like texture flows easily for smooth coverage or artistic techniques, and tools clean up effortlessly with water.

Key statistics
What size do I need?
Drying and Curing
✦ Touch dry in 20 - 30 minutes
✦ Ready for recoating in 1 hour
✦ Full cure achieved in 21 days
